# Время в минутах, как часто будет делатся проверка конекта к БД.
# Default: 240 min, set to 0 to disable
idleConnectionTestPeriod
# The time (in minutes), for a connection to remain unused before it is closed off. Do not use aggressive values here!
# Default: 60 minutes, set to 0 to disable
idleMaxAge
# In order to reduce lock contention and thus improve performance, each incoming connection request picks off
# a connection from a pool that has thread-affinity, i.e. pool[threadId % partition_count].
# The higher this number, the better your performance will be for the case when you have plenty of short-lived threads.
# Beyond a certain threshold, maintenence of these pools will start to have a negative effect on performance
# (and only for the case when connections on a partition start running out).
# Default: 3, minimum: 1, recommended: 3-4 (but very app specific)
partitionCount
# The number of connections to create per partition. Setting this to 5 with 3 partitions means you will have 15 unique
# connections to the database. Note that BoneCP will not create all these connections in one go but rather start off with
# minConnectionsPerPartition and gradually increase connections as required.
# Default: 50
maxConnectionsPerPartition
# The number of connections to start off with per partition.
# Default: 10
minConnectionsPerPartition
# When the available connections are about to run out, BoneCP will dynamically create new ones in batches.
# This property controls how many new connections to create in one go (up to a maximum of maxConnectionsPerPartition).
# Note: This is a per partition setting.
# Default: 10
acquireIncrement
# Number of threads to create that will handle releasing a connection. Useful when your application is doing lots
# of work on each connection (i.e. perform an SQL query, do lots of non-DB stuff and perform another query),
# otherwise will probably slow things down.
# Default: 3, Set to 0 to disable.
releaseHelperThreads
# Instruct the pool to create a helper thread to watch over connection acquires that are never released (or released twice).
# When the pool detects such a condition it will log a stack trace of the source of the problem.
# This is intended for debugging purposes only - it incurs a large negative performance impact.
# Default: false
closeConnectionWatch
# Stops the pool from talking to the database until a first getConnection() request is made.
# Default: false
lazyInit
